Remix of the Lack Enclosure for my Sovol SV06, largely based on DarkDoldier's make, but will fit any taller printer of a similar size.

Parts: 
3mm x 440mm x 540mm Acrylic Sheets (Two, for the sides)
3mm x 220mm x 540mm Acrylic Sheets (Four, for the doors)
A XT60 30cm Extension Cable (Male to Female)
Superglue (For securing the Table Connectors)
M6 x 20 Screws (Four, to attach Table Connectors)
M6 x 160 Screws (Four, to attach Bottom Corners and Leg Spacers)
M6 x 50 Screws (Four,  to attach to Top Corners)
3.5 x 25 Screws (Multiple, to attach the all other components)
 
Edits:
I increased the clearance at the top of the printer by a few cm, to match the original by Prusa, and allow for the use of their filament guide. I also added cable passthrough holes on the top of the legs, echoing the bottom, which gives a neater finish for anything mounted onto the roof of the enclosure. To allow for better airflow, when printing PLA, I put hinges on the back and attached two doors which are easily removed or left off entirely. The design still allows for a 440mm x 540mm solid back though, if desired.  

I edited the hinges, to echo the triangular design of the sides and designed a fresh support for half way up the plexiglass, as others have suggested that this is prone to warping. I had some spare push open door catches and so used these, allowing for minimal door handles.

Finally, I added rubber feet for levelling and vibration dampening, which seem to work well. 

All parts are printed in PETG.
